ATMS nearby 1 The Triangle, Kingston upon Thames KT1 3RU, United Kingdom



HSBC Bank plc

Approximately 1.96 km away
Address: 90 Eden St, London, Kingston upon Thames KT1 1DJ, United Kingdom

ATM

Approximately 1.96 km away
Address: 82 Burlington Rd, New Malden KT3 4NU, UK

HSBC Bank Plc

Approximately 1.96 km away
Address: 54 Clarence St, Kingston upon Thames KT1 1NP, United Kingdom

TSB Bank

Approximately 1.97 km away
Address: 82a Eden St, Kingston upon Thames KT1 1DJ, United Kingdom

Lloyds Bank

Approximately 1.98 km away
Address: 83 Clarence St, Kingston upon Thames KT1 1RE, United Kingdom

Cheltenham & Gloucester PLC

Approximately 1.98 km away
Address: 80A Eden Street, Kingston upon Thames KT1 1DJ, United Kingdom

Lloyds Bank Plc

Approximately 1.98 km away
Address: 83 Clarence Street, Kingston upon Thames, Surrey KT1 1RE, United Kingdom

Britannia

Approximately 1.98 km away
Address: 80 Eden Street, Kingston upon Thames KT1 1DD, United Kingdom

Santander

Approximately 1.99 km away
Address: 59 Eden Street, Town Centre, Kingston upon Thames KT1 1DH, United Kingdom